The size of Cohuna is approximately 161.1 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 71.9% of total area. The population of Cohuna in 2016 was 2428 people. By 2021 the population was 2415 showing a population decline of 0.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cohuna is 60-69 years. Households in Cohuna are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cohuna work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 78.10% of the homes in Cohuna were owner-occupied compared with 77.60% in 2016.
